What is the partial products method in multiplication?
Back
The partial products method involves breaking down each digit of a number into its place value, multiplying each part separately, and then adding the results together.

When multiplying a 2-digit number by a 1-digit number, what should you do?
Back
Multiply the value of both digits in the 2-digit number by the one-digit number, then add both sums.

What is the first step in using the box method for multiplication?
Back
Draw a box and divide it into sections based on the digits of the numbers being multiplied.
